Houston tops Bearkats 11-3

HOUSTON – The Sam Houston State Bearkats fell to the Houston Cougars 11-3 in six innings on Wednesday evening.

Originally slated to be played in Huntsville, the game was moved to Cougars Stadium due to inclement weather.

Although the Bearkats had two more hits than the Cougars, it was the long ball that was the difference, with the Cougars launching four home runs out of the park. Sam Houston State fell to 4-7 on the season and will head to Baton Rouge, Louisiana where they will play four games, partaking in the LSU Purple and Gold Challenge.

The Bearkats scored first, plating a pair of runs in the top of the second with the help of singles from junior Madilyn Weatherly, junior Sheridan Fisher and senior Megan McDonald.

Weatherly had herself a three-hit night, with singles in the second, third and fifth innings. McDonald, freshman Emily Grill and Fisher each notched a pair of hits.

Annie Bailey (0-2) was given the nod in the circle, but after the Cougars hit a couple of long balls to put them up 4-2, Brooklyn Devine took over. Devine pitched 1.3 of an inning, but the Cougars offense plated two more runs off a few walks, a hit by pitch and a double to center field.

Sophomore Reagan Dunn would then come in to finish out the game, pitching 2 2/3 innings with four hits, five runs and two strikeouts.

Houston's offense proved to be too much, plating two runs in the second, four runs in the third and five runs in the sixth to put the run-rule into effect. Cougars starting pitcher Megan Lee gave up a run in the fifth, but finished the night with seven strikeouts to earn the win.
